Progression at a moderate rate over many months to years is the most common prognosis. [1] [9] In addition to the speed of inflammation-based heart muscle injury, the prognosis of eosinophilic myocarditis may be dominated by that of its underlying cause. For example, an underlying malignant cause for eosinophilia may be survival-limiting.
Loeffler endocarditis is a form of heart disease characterized by a stiffened, poorly-functioning heart caused by infiltration of the heart by white blood cells known as eosinophils. Eosinophilia is a condition in which the eosinophil count in the peripheral blood exceeds 5 × 10 8 /L (500/μL). [1] Hypereosinophilia is an elevation in an individual's circulating blood eosinophil count above 1.5 × 10 9 /L (i.e. 1,500/μL).

Hypereosinophilic syndrome is a disease characterized by a persistently elevated eosinophil count (≥ 1500 eosinophils/mm³) in the blood for at least six months without any recognizable cause, with involvement of either the heart, nervous system, or bone marrow. [5]
